It’s all about the comments

I think one of the things I like – no, love! – the most about blogging is the ability for others to share their own thoughts on what I’ve written by way of the comments feature. Thinking about it, this potential for input from readers is really what keeps me coming back to blogging day after day, writing and sharing my thoughts and life with the world instead of keeping them locked up in a private journal for my eyes only.

So when I signed up for another month of NaBloPoMo (National Blog Posting Month) on BlogHer, I was intrigued to see that the theme for the month of June is Comment.

NaBloPoMo June 2014

Wondering how on earth anyone could possibly write a whole month’s worth of blog posts on commenting, I headed over to take a look at the list of prompts for June – and realized right away that apparently I don’t have enough imagination! I was inspired by several of the questions before me – things like, “Who owns the comment section: the blog writer or the blog readers?” and, “Are you good at holding your tongue, or do you need to say what is on your mind?” and, “Do you strongly support freedom of speech? Do you think it should have limits?” Several of the prompts triggered an immediate response that made me want to dive right in and start writing; others caught me a bit off-guard and made me stop and think. In any case, I’m looking forward to seeing what emerges as I and my fellow NaBloPoMo-ers tackle these interesting subjects. I think June is going to be an interesting time of exploration, definition, and discussion, and I’m looking forward to being a part of it!

As always, I probably won’t follow the prompts list entirely – I’ll still be featuring my regular Gratitude Linkup, Tangled Tuesday, Photo Friday, and Photo A Day Challenge posts, as well as any other topic that happens to take my fancy on any given day… but that’s the beauty of NaBloPoMo, isn’t it?! What you choose to post is entirely up to you – the prompts are there as a resource, but all that matters is that you post something every day throughout the month.
